    If you add the external PS, then does the internal PS become redundant? Assuming so - they should make a version of the product that does not contain an internal PS in the first place - saving money but knowing it can only ever be used with the external PS.

  • @jasonsaxon5620

    @jasonsaxon5620

    Жыл бұрын

    When a PSU-XR is connected to a host product the power supply inside the product does not become redundant. Depending on the product the PSU-XR is capable of taking over up to 3 sections of the circuit in side the host leaving the internal power supply to do the rest, house keeping, screen etc

  • @oliverking9183

    @oliverking9183

    Жыл бұрын

    No, the internal power supply does not become redundant. It works along side it. For example in the i9 integrated amplifier the PSU takes over the preamp stage and works with the internal supply to provide a better supply to the power amp stage.

    It doesn't sound unique it sounds like a class h power supply what class do they call it?

  • @cyrusaudio

    @cyrusaudio

    Жыл бұрын

    Class H is an amplifier topology where the power rails are modulated ahead of the audio signal, the PSU-XR synthesises rails as requested by the host product which is quite different.
